phpMyAdmin '$host' Variable HTML Injection Vulnerability
phpMyAdmin is prone to an HTML-injection vulnerability because the application fails to properly sanitize user-supplied input. Attacker-supplied HTML and script code would run in the context of the affected browser, potentially allowing the attacker to steal cookie-based authentication credentials or to control how the site is rendered to the user. Other attacks are also possible. phpMyAdmin versions 3.4.x prior to 3.4.9 are affected. |
